【题目】 Just ask any new parent: Adding a baby to a household can also add stress to a career. Nowa new study backs that up with some astonishing numbers: After sciencetechnologyengineeringand mathematicsSTEMprofessionals become parents43%of women and 23% of men switch fieldstransition(转变)to part-time workor leave the workforce entirely.

Many researchers and parents already knew that STEM can be unwelcoming to parentsparticularly mothers. But“the considerable departure was astonishing”says Erin Cechan assistant professor of sociology at the University of Michigan in Ann Arbor and lead author of the studypublished in the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ences. For both genders“the proportions were higher than we expected. ”

The surprisingly high reduction rate for men also highlights that“parenthood in STEM is not just a mothers'issueit's a worker issue”Cech says. She hopes that the findings“might motivate changes"such as more paid parental leave from both government and employers and policies that better support flexible work time without a tight routine. “We are not suggesting that people who want families should avoid STEMthat's not the solution”she emphasizes.

By 201878% of new fathers were still working in STEMthe vast majority full time. For new mothers68% were still in STEMbut only 57% worked full time. For professionals without childrenon the other hand84% of men and 76% of women were predicted to still be working in STEM full time in 2018. For the new parents across all fields16% of women were working part-time and 15% had left the workforceas compared with just 2% and 3%respectivelyfor men. These sharp differences make clear thateven though the reduction rate for fathers is higher than expectedmothers still face particular career challenges.
